feat(acms): implement Real-time Index Sync / UKOIndexer with pluggable analyzers
Implement the UKOIndexer service that produces UKO triples from resources
using pluggable domain-specific analyzers, wraps each triple with provenance
metadata, and simultaneously indexes into text, vector, and graph backends.

Key design decisions and components:

- UKOIndexer orchestrates the full index lifecycle: add_resource,
  update_resource (remove-then-add), remove_resource, and maintenance
  triggers. Each operation fires lifecycle hooks (on_indexed, on_removed,
  on_error) so callers can observe progress.

- Analyzer selection is pluggable via ContentAnalyzer protocol. The indexer
  accepts a registry mapping resource types to analyzers. PythonAnalyzer
  and MarkdownAnalyzer are provided as built-in implementations.

- LocationContentReader protocol abstracts file I/O with a base_dir
  parameter for path-traversal prevention (post-resolve validation rejects
  paths escaping the base directory and non-regular files).

- UKOTriple model includes a @model_validator ensuring at least one of
  object_uri or object_value is populated, preventing empty triples at
  construction time.

- Triple removal uses scoped deletion via uko:sourceResource predicate to
  avoid shared-subject collision — only triples originating from the
  specific resource are removed, not all triples for a shared subject.

- _resource_subjects.pop is deferred until after all backend removal
  operations succeed, preventing inconsistent state on partial failure.

- analyzer.analyze() is wrapped in try/except so that analyzer errors
  produce an IndexResult with error details rather than propagating
  exceptions to callers.

- All lifecycle hook calls are guarded via _fire_on_indexed,
  _fire_on_removed, and _fire_on_error helpers that catch and log hook
  exceptions without disrupting the indexing pipeline.

- max_triples parameter (default 50,000) bounds analyzer output size to
  prevent runaway resource consumption.

- ResourceFileWatcher monitors filesystem paths via watchdog and triggers
  re-indexing callbacks on file changes with configurable debouncing.
  Emits RESOURCE_MODIFIED domain events via EventBus when file changes
  are detected. Debounce timers coalesce rapid edits into a single
  callback invocation. Thread-safe design with daemon threads for clean
  shutdown.

- SearchResult.__post_init__ validates score is in [0.0, 1.0], correctly
  rejecting NaN values.

- Placeholder embedding uses [1.0] instead of [float(len(content))] to
  avoid leaking content size information.

- isinstance check on graph_backend ensures GraphIndexBackend protocol
  compliance at runtime.

- Test doubles extracted to features/mocks/uko_indexer_mocks.py for reuse
  across BDD steps and Robot helpers.

UKO Indexer — Real-time Index Synchronization

The UKO Indexer orchestrates the analysis of resources into UKO triples and simultaneously indexes content into text, vector, and graph backends. It implements the index lifecycle (add/change/remove/maintenance) with graceful degradation when optional backends are unavailable.

Based on docs/specification.md > ACMS > Real-time Index Synchronization and Custom Index Backends.

Architecture

Resource ──► AnalyzerRegistry.get_for_resource()
                 │
                 ▼
            ContentReader.read_content()
                 │
                 ▼
           Analyzer.analyze(content, resource_uri)
                 │
                 ▼
           attach_provenance(triples, resource, timestamp)
                 │
                 ├──► GraphIndexBackend.add_triple()   (required)
                 ├──► TextIndexBackend.index_document() (optional — graceful degradation)
                 └──► VectorIndexBackend.index_embedding() (optional — graceful degradation)

UKOIndexer

Main service class that produces UKO triples from resources and indexes them into all available backends.

Constructor

Parameter Type Required Description
analyzer_registry AnalyzerRegistry Yes Registry of domain analyzers
graph_backend GraphIndexBackend Yes Backend for UKO triple storage
text_backend TextIndexBackend | None No Backend for full-text indexing
vector_backend VectorIndexBackend | None No Backend for embedding indexing
content_reader ContentReader | None No Reader for resource content (default: LocationContentReader)
lifecycle_hook IndexLifecycleHook | None No Callback for lifecycle events (default: DefaultLifecycleHook)
max_triples int No Maximum triples per resource (default: 50_000). Must be positive.

Methods

Method Signature Returns Description
index_resource (resource: Resource, *, project: str) IndexResult Full indexing pipeline
remove_resource (resource_id: str, *, project: str) None Remove from all indices
reindex_resource (resource: Resource, *, project: str) IndexResult Remove + re-index

Properties

Property Type Description
analyzer_registry AnalyzerRegistry The analyzer registry
indexed_resource_count int Number of currently indexed resources
has_text_backend bool Whether text backend is available
has_vector_backend bool Whether vector backend is available

Graceful Degradation

If text_backend or vector_backend is None, the corresponding indexing step is silently skipped. The graph_backend is always required. Error counts from individual backend failures are recorded in IndexResult.errors without aborting the entire indexing operation.

Index Backends (Write-side Protocols)

These are write-side protocols for indexing. They are distinct from the existing read-side query protocols (TextBackend, VectorBackend, GraphBackend) in backends.py.

TextIndexBackend

Method Signature Returns
index_document (project: str, doc_id: str, content: str, metadata: dict[str, str]) IndexedDocument
search (project: str, query: str, *, limit: int = 20) list[SearchResult]
remove_document (project: str, doc_id: str) None
rebuild_index (project: str) None

VectorIndexBackend

Method Signature Returns
index_embedding (project: str, doc_id: str, embedding: list[float], metadata: dict[str, str]) None
search_similar (project: str, query_embedding: list[float], limit: int = 20, min_relevance: float = 0.0) list[SearchResult]
remove_embedding (project: str, doc_id: str) None

GraphIndexBackend

Method Signature Returns
add_triple (project: str, subject: str, predicate: str, obj: str) None
query (project: str, sparql: str) list[dict[str, str]]
remove_triples (project: str, subject: str | None, predicate: str | None, obj: str | None) None

Result Types

IndexedDocument

Field Type Description
project str Namespaced project name
doc_id str Document identifier
char_count int Character count (non-negative, default 0)

SearchResult

Field Type Description
doc_id str Document identifier (non-empty)
content str Matched text snippet
score float Relevance score in [0.0, 1.0]
metadata dict[str, str] Backend-specific metadata

Provenance

ProvenanceMetadata

Tracks the origin and validity of indexed triples.

Field Type Description
source_resource str Resource ULID that produced the triple
source_path str File path of the source resource
source_range str Line range (e.g. "10-25"), empty if whole file
valid_from datetime When the triple was indexed (defaults to now(UTC))
is_current bool Whether the triple is still current (default: True)

ProvenancedTriple

Wrapper combining a UKOTriple with its ProvenanceMetadata.

Field Type Description
triple UKOTriple The underlying UKO triple
provenance ProvenanceMetadata Origin and validity metadata

IndexResult

Summary returned by index_resource() and reindex_resource().

Field Type Description
resource_id str ULID of the indexed resource
triple_count int Number of triples produced
text_docs_indexed int Text documents indexed (0 or 1)
embeddings_indexed int Embeddings indexed (0 or 1)
analyzer_domain str Domain of the analyzer used
errors tuple[str, ...] Non-fatal error messages

Protocols

ContentReader

Protocol for reading resource content. Decouples the indexer from the filesystem.

Method Signature Returns
read_content (resource: Resource) str

Default implementation: LocationContentReader — reads from resource.location via the local filesystem.

IndexLifecycleHook

Callback protocol for index lifecycle events.

Method Signature Returns
on_indexed (result: IndexResult) None
on_removed (resource_id: str, project: str) None
on_error (resource_id: str, error: str) None

Default implementation: DefaultLifecycleHook — logs events via structlog.

In-Memory Stubs

For testing, three in-memory stub implementations are provided:

  • InMemoryTextIndexBackend — dict-based full-text storage with substring search
  • InMemoryVectorIndexBackend — dict-based embedding storage (no real similarity)
  • InMemoryGraphIndexBackend — list-based triple storage with pattern matching

ResourceFileWatcher

Monitors filesystem paths via watchdog and triggers re-indexing callbacks on file changes with configurable debouncing.

Constructor

Parameter Type Required Description
indexer UKOIndexer Yes Indexer for re-index on change
project str Yes Project namespace
debounce_seconds float No Debounce delay (default: 0.5)
on_change Callable[[str, str, FileChangeType], None] | None No Optional change callback
event_bus EventBus | None No Optional event bus for RESOURCE_MODIFIED emission

FileChangeType

StrEnum with values: CREATED, MODIFIED, DELETED, MOVED.

Methods

Method Signature Returns Description
watch (resource_id: str, path: Path) None Start watching a file path for a resource
unwatch (resource_id: str) None Stop watching a resource
shutdown () None Stop all observers and clean up

Known Limitations

  • Placeholder vector embedding: The vector backend receives a constant [1.0] placeholder instead of a real embedding. Real embedding model integration is tracked as a follow-up to issue #578.
